Meaning of -phobiac | Babel Free

Phrase CEFR B2
/-ˈfəʊbɪæk/

Definitions

  1. Used to form adjectives indicating a fear of a specific thing.
    morpheme
  2. Used to form adjectives indicating a dislike or aversion.
    morpheme
  3. Used as a synonym of -phobic to form nouns.
    morpheme

Examples

“claustrophobiac”
“Anglophobiac”
